Hey, this is my first post, and also my second in a way, for I am also going to post this in the non-specific area. Here is my question.
I bought three weeks ago a 2005 Ford Focus ZX3 5-speed Manual, last night I took my girlfriend out to an empty parking lot to teach her how to drive a manual transmission. The car has never had any problems with shifting whatsoever, infact I always thought the clutch was a little too soft. Anyway, she did extremely well with her first time, and only stalled the car twice, though they were pretty bad stalls. We never got up to fourth gear, since we were in a parking lot, and it shifted fine the whole time. However, when I got back in to drive to pick up a movie, it wouldn't go into reverse to pull out of the parking spot. So I let it coast out of the spot since it was on a hill, and we took the highway to test if it needed to be at a higher RPM to get into the slot. It wouldn't go into the slot to select 5th on the highway either. So essentially I now have a four speed manual transmission with the 5 speed gear ratios, and no reverse. I am going to take it into the dealership tomorrow, but I wanted to see if was something that I could possibly easily fix. At any rate, I appreciate any help that can be given, and thank you for taking the time to read this. Sean |
